Bethune-Cookman University is a private university in Daytona Beach, Florida, founded in 1904. Known for its historically black college heritage, it has a strong regional reputation for its programs in business, education, and nursing. The university's marching band, the Marching Wildcats, is renowned for its high-energy performances and has been featured in various national events.

Historical Tuition Costs

Based on historical data, in-state tuition is expected to rise by approximately $262 per year over the next three years, reaching $16,128 in 2024, and $16,390 in 2025, and $16,651 in 2026.

Admissions

Bethune-Cookman University admissions is not very selective with an acceptance rate of 85%. Typically, admitted students score between 830-980 on the SAT or 15-18 on the ACT. The application deadline can be found the the institutions website.
